Amery Sandford is an animator, illustrator, musician, and printmaker based in Montreal, Canada.

She received her Bachelor of Fine Arts degree from NSCAD University in Halifax, Nova Scotia, Canada, where she studied from 2010 to 2014. After completing her BFA, Amery moved to Newfoundland to do the Don Wright Scholarship residency at St. Michael's Printshop in St. John's. She became heavily involved in the local art scene and even served on the board of directors at Eastern Edge Gallery. It was there that she started to make gig posters for local shows and tried her hand as a guitarist in a few punk bands.

Her newfound interest in illustration and music led her to do an internship at Hatch Show Print in Nashville, Tennessee in 2016, a printshop situated within the Country Music Hall of Fame. During her time at Hatch, Amery got to work with clients and design and print posters the old-fashioned way, using letterpress typefaces and photo plates. She learned a great deal about design basics in a very hands-on way and also enjoyed exploring the city's honky-tonk bars and making many new friends along the way.

In 2019, Amery went on to earn a Master of Fine Arts degree in Print Media from Concordia University in Montreal. During her time at Concordia, she focused on producing large-scale print installations using screen printing and creating soft sculptures that incorporated fibres and recycled materials. Her MFA Thesis show Once in a Lifetime was exhibited at Atelier Circulaire, an artist run center that focuses on printed matter in Montreal.

After graduating, Amery worked as an artist assistant for notable Canadian illustrator Raymond Biesinger. She has since become a respected artist in the music industry, creating show posters, music videos, and other projects that showcase her fun and floppy illustration style. She also runs a small riso printing press out of her studio in the Mile End neighbourhood of Montreal called Amery Press.

In addition to her visual art practice, Amery is also an accomplished musician. She is a member of two bands: Born At Midnite with her collaborator David Carriere (TOPS, Marci), and a solo project called Alpen Glow.
